A family of four needs to make an annual income below $31,005 for free meals or $44,122 for reduced price meals. For 2014, a family of two needs to make an annual income below $20,449 to be eligible for free meals or below $29,100 for reduced price meals.

There are a total of 490 students and 30 teachers at Rolling Hills Elementary School, for a student to teacher ratio of 17 to 1. Student/teacher ratio is calculated by dividing the total number of students by the total number of full-time equivalent teachers.
